On Fri, Jan 13, 2023 at 11:33:46AM +0100, Krzysztof Kozlowski wrote:
> On some SoCs the watchdog device is actually mixed with timer, e.g.
> the qcom,msm-timer on older Qualcomm SoCs where this is actually one
> hardware block responsible for both system timer and watchdog.
>
> Allow calling such device nodes as "timer".
